About Eden Boys' School, Birmingham

Eden Boys’ School, Birminghamis a Muslim faith-based secondary school for 11 to 18 year old boys, which welcomes pupils from all faiths and none. We opened in Perry Barr in 2015 and, like all Star schools, we have a leadership specialism. We are extremely proud to be one of the highest performing schools in the country, with the 4th best Progress 8 score nationally for our 2024 GCSE results.

We were graded as ‘Outstanding’ in all areas by Ofsted during our first inspection in May 2018. At our last inspection in December 2024, the school was commended for upholding the same high standards of academic excellence, teaching, character development and behaviour that resulted in the school’s previous ‘Outstanding’ rating.

We have an exemplary reputation for excellence in every aspect of school life. We provide a knowledge-based academic curriculum alongside a rich and diverse leadership programme that grows character and inspires charitable and social action. Our pursuit of educational excellence is based upon our fundamental belief that every pupil has the capacity to become a successful and inspirational leader.

Who we’re looking for

We’re looking for a highly organised individual to help create, maintain and manage a safe learning environment for our young people. You will have a keen eye for detail to ensure our facilities are clean, safe and well maintained.

The successful candidate will be a committed team player with excellent organisational and technical skills. You will have the ability to effectively problem solve and provide excellent customer service to our community.

You will have:

  • An understanding of the main Health and Safety Regulations, including COSHH and risk assessment, and how they apply in a school environment.
  • Experience of carrying out specialist building maintenance work, within the reasonable capacity of a normal handyperson.
  • Experience of keeping work records.
  • The ability to undertake a range of caretaking and cleaning duties.
  • The ability to identify work priorities and manage own workload, whilst ensuring that lower priority work is kept up to date.
